①Stars Who Gave Birth to Stars in Popular Culture
Is it because they have celebrity DNA? The entertainment industry is seeing an increasing number of 'celebrity families.' The second generation, armed with the 'talent' inherited from their parents, tends to avoid being labeled as 'so-and-so's son or daughter.' There is a growing atmosphere where they carve their own paths by using pseudonyms and participating in various audition programs to avoid riding on their parents' coattails.
Yoo In-chon, Minister of Culture, Sports and Tourism, began his acting career as a theater actor in 1971. After passing MBC's 6th open talent audition in 1973, he appeared in the MBC drama "Jeonwon Ilgi," which aired from 1980 to 2002, becoming a beloved national actor. In the late 2000s, he stopped acting to start his career as a cultural and arts administrator. He served as chairman of the Seoul Foundation for Arts and Culture, was the first Minister of Culture, Sports and Tourism under the Lee Myung-bak administration, and held positions such as special cultural advisor to the presidential office and chairman of the Seoul Arts Center. Since 2014, he returned to the theater stage as an actor and director, and was appointed Minister of Culture, Sports and Tourism again on October 7 last year.
The film "Spring in Seoul," which attracted 10 million viewers last December, featured Minister Yoo's son. Actor Nam Yoon-ho (real name Yoo Dae-sik) played Kang Dong-chan, the operations staff officer of the Capital Defense Command (Su-gyeong-sa) and the right-hand man of Lee Tae-shin, the Capital Defense Commander played by Jung Woo-sung. Having studied acting at UCLA in the United States, he began his acting career in 2012 with the play "Killing Romantics" and shared the stage with his father in "Pericles."

The children of singers who dominated the 1980s and 1990s are also actively working as idols recently. Anton (real name Lee Chan-young), son of singer Yoon Sang (real name Lee Yoon-sang) and actress Shim Hye-jin, debuted last September as part of the multinational boy group RISE under SM Entertainment. RISE is considered one of the hottest rising idol groups recently. Anton, known as 'Yoon Sang's son,' attracted attention for his handsome looks as a child appearing on TV. He showed his father songs he wrote himself and received permission to pursue a career as a singer.
Si-eun Park (real name Park Si-eun), daughter of 90s original dance singer Park Nam-jung, debuted with the group STAYC. Si-eun often appeared on TV with Park Nam-jung since childhood and started her career as a child actress. She debuted as a member of STAYC in 2020 and released various hit songs such as "Bubble," "ASAP," and "Teddy Bear."
Shim Hye-won, daughter of singer Shim Shin, debuted as Bello in the group Kiss of Life last July. Before debuting, Bello showed her talent by participating in the lyrics and composition of LE SSERAFIM's "UNFORGIVEN."

Actress Lee Hyo-jung is well known to the younger generation as 'Lee Yoo-jin's dad.' Actress Lee Yoo-jin debuted in 2013 with the MBC drama "Goddess of Fire, Jung Yi," gained recognition by challenging to become an idol singer on Mnet's "Produce 101" Season 2 in 2017, and appeared in the KBS2 weekend drama "Three Bold Siblings" as an actress. Recently, she attracted attention by revealing her solo living lifestyle on MBC's variety show "I Live Alone." After Lee Hyo-jung was shown using a secondhand trading app on the show, they even filmed a commercial for the company together, becoming a hot 'rich family' topic.
Although not father-daughter or father-son relationships, many family celebrities share talent through bloodlines. Singer Shim Soo-bong is the great-aunt of singer Son Tae-jin, who reached the top in survival programs like "Phantom Singer" and "Burning Trotman." Son Tae-jin belongs to the group Forte di Quattro and actively performs various music genres, ranging from popera to trot. Shim Soo-bong's older sister is Son Tae-jin's mother. The two have shown their affection by performing joint stages on broadcasts.
Actor Jo Tae-kwan is the nephew of actors Choi Soo-jong and Ha Hee-ra. Jo Tae-kwan, a Korean-Canadian actor who gained recognition through the drama "Descendants of the Sun" (2016), is also the son of singer Jo Ha-moon. Actress Choi Myung-gil and actor Kwon Yul (real name Kwon Se-in) are aunt and nephew, and actor Lee Dong-gun is an eighth cousin on the maternal side of actor Sung Hyuk (real name Hong Sung-hyuk). Musical actress Ok Joo-hyun, formerly of the group Fin.K.L, is a sixth cousin of actor Park Hyung-sik, formerly of the group ZE:A.
